A 90-kilogram bag of ndengu ( green grams) is retailing with the highest price in Kitale, at 13,500 shillings and lowest in Isiolo at 6000 shillings.
In Nairobi, the 90 Kilogram bag is currently being sold at 11,100 shillings, 12,000 shillings in Kajiado, 13,500 shillings in Kitale, 6,000 shillings in Isiolo, and 6,500 shillings in Nakuru.
Another variety of Ndengu, like Polish/Nylon, varies from the ordinary because of their polished look, hence the name Polish or Nylongreen grams is also retailing at an average of 143 shillings per kilogram.
The same polish/nylon variety is retailing at 122 shillings in Nairobi and 71 shillings in Kitale, 85 shillings in Rwanda; Gicumbi, 86 shillings, Uganda; Lira, 49 shillings, Tanzania, Kigoma, 56 shillings, Iringa, 104 shillings.
Kenya Dengu, Makueni/Uncle variety of green grams, is being sold at a retail price of 130 shillings and 125 shillings wholesale price. A 90-kilogram bag of the same is going for 11,250 shillings.
A 90-kilogram bag of Dolichos (Njahi, Mbumbu) in Nairobi is retailing at 12,800 shillings, Kitale, 11,700 shillings, Nakuru, 14,000 shillings, and Isiolo,14,500 shillings. Njahi is being sold at a wholesale price of 141 shillings in Nairobi and 154 shillings in Nakuru.
The Ndengu special is preferred over the ordinary Ndengu due to its filling and does not cause heartburn or digestive gas. It is being sold at a retail price of 80 shillings wholesale Price 65 shillings and 100-kilogram bag retails at 6,500 shillings
